On the sports side, Manchester City defended their Premier League title by a single point over Liverpool for the 2nd time within the last 5 seasons. Arsenal returned to European play, as they finished 5th, meaning they went to the Europa League. This year, the Gunners are currently leading the Premier League going into the World Cup break. Liverpool beat Chelsea in the FA Cup on penalties. Real Madrid won the UEFA Champions League over Liverpool, Eintracht Frankfurt won the Europa League over Rangers on penalties, and Roma won the first-ever installment of the UEFA Europa Conference League over Feyenoord. Argentina won the 2022 FIFA World Cup over defending champions France in penalties. In the NHL, the Colorado Avalanche stopped the Tampa Bay Lightning's three-peat bid of winning the Stanley Cup by winning it all.. The Houston Astros won the World Series over the Philadelphia Phillies in the MLB. The Los Angeles Rams beat the Cincinnati Bengals to win the Super Bowl in the NFL. The Golden State Warriors won the NBA Finals. The Los Angeles Galaxy won the 2022 MLS Cup on penalties over Philadelphia Union.   10. Welcome to ATRL's Best of 2022! It's the most wonderful time of the year, and it's time for you to give us your best. You are invited to share all of the music, entertainment, and moments that defined your year. Guidelines for Best of 2022: 1. It's your show You get one thread per year to share your stuff. No one else gets to vote on your lists and countdowns, your thread is all about you. 2. Start with an intro Use your first post to tell us what you're going to do. Will you list your top songs, singles, videos, albums, artists, concerts, TV shows, movies, video games, whatever? It's all up to you. Let us know first, and get into the actual list later. 3. Don't post all at once You want to post your countdown(s) in installments. For example, if you have one list of 50 songs, post it in daily blocks of 5 or so. The suspense makes things interesting. 4. Use words and pictures Your thread will be more fun to follow if you put some effort into it. Describe every item on your list with at least a full sentence. If you add pictures and graphics, that's even better. 5. Actively participate We encourage you to support each other. Reply with your comments to let them know you're reading. If someone is taking the time to read your thread, try and return the favor. Be supportive and have fun. 6. Limited time only This year, the Best of 2022 forum will be open until January 8th, 2023 Finish up before then! If you need inspiration, take a look at ATRL's Best of 2021!
